Submillimeter-wave endfire slotline antennas

Abstract: A B S T R A C TEndfire slotline antennas have been integrated on a 1.75pm thick dielectric substrate. The thin substrate allows the upper frequency limit of the slotline antennas to be pushed beyond ITHz. Antennas have been fabricated and tested at 350 and SOZGHz. The patterns exhibit high directivity (15+/-ldB) and wide bandwidth. In the future, these antennas will be combined with SIS junctions for low noise astronomical receivers. “…In particular, after the field is coupled to the FS-LTSA, the effect of substrate radiation, surface-waves, and dispersion are mostly eliminated. This goal has been mostly achieved by [5] where substrate etching was used to create an antenna on a thin (<2µm) SiO 2 /Si 3 N 4 membrane. The antenna presented here has some distinct advantages over thin membrane antennas: the metallic-slit based antenna has lower conductor loss due to increased conductor surface area, it is less delicate due to the material and thickness, and the manufacturing process doesn't require harsh etchants (EDP, HF, etc).…”

“…The induced pulse distortion limits the ability for these antennas to function as a broadband THz time-domain spectrometer (THz-TDS) source. In [5,6] the undesired effects associated with the substrate are mitigated by using a slotline antenna on a thin dielectric membrane. This method functions well but has several issues: the resulting antenna is delicate, manufacturing requires harsh etchants, and the conductor loss is relatively high.…”
